standard> An ITU-Tstandardprotocolsuite for the DTE-DCE interface in a packet-switched network, approved by IsO. X.25 definesstandard physical layer, data link layer and network layers (layers 1 through 3). It was developed to describe how data passes into and out of public data communications networks. X.25 networks are in use throughout the world. Document: IsO 8208. several other ITU-T recommendations are relevant to {packet switching}: {X.3}, {X.28}, {X.29}, {X.75}. (1996-08-10)
